投资组合的优化旨在对资金进行分配组合,得到各项资产的最优分配权重,并在权衡投资收益和风险的基础上使投资达到期望效用最大化。在研究过程中,首先运用Monte Carlo随机模拟方法预测各资产的收益率期望值,计算出收益率标准差和各资产间的相关系数,进而求解资产的组合风险。然后将VaR(Value at Risk)条件引入到模型中,建立以资产组合收益为最大目标,以资产组合的VAR为约束条件的投资组合优化模型,计算出资产分配比重。最后通过实例分析资产价格走势和检验分布假设,验证模型的合理性和可行性,为投资者的决策提供理论和应用依据。
The optimization of a portfolio aims at allocating and allocating funds, obtaining the optimal distribution weight of each asset, and maximizing the expected utility of the investment on the basis of weighing investment returns and risks. In the research process, we first use Monte Carlo stochastic simulation method to predict the expected return of each asset, calculate the standard deviation of return and the correlation coefficient between assets, and then solve the portfolio risk. Then the VaR (Value at Risk) condition is introduced into the model to establish a portfolio optimization model with the portfolio return as the maximum objective and the portfolio VAR as the constraint condition to calculate the asset allocation proportion. Finally, by analyzing the asset price trend and the test distribution hypothesis by examples, the rationality and feasibility of the model are validated to provide theory and application basis for the investors’ decision-making.
